Fold Equity Poker Strategy is a crucial concept in Texas Hold'em that allows players to profit even before they have a complete hand. By creating fold pressure, players can force opponents to fold in unfavorable situations, thus winning the pot directly. This article analyzes how to improve Fold Equity using position, board presence, bet size, and strategic approaches through real-world hand replays, and explains when to apply pressure or fold. When players can combine Fold Equity with Hand Equity, they can significantly improve their overall strategic depth and long-term profitability.

Three-Street Planning Poker Strategy is a crucial ability in Texas Hold'em, evolving from single-point decision-making to holistic strategic planning. Many players make decisions independently on each street, leading to inconsistent strategies and difficulty in maximizing EV. This article analyzes real-world hands to demonstrate how to plan a complete Turn and River strategy on the Flop, and introduces three typical three-street strategies: Value, Control, and Bluff. When players can establish clear and consistent three-street planning, they can significantly improve decision-making quality and long-term profitability.

Marginal Hand Poker Strategy is one of the key factors affecting long-term profitability in Texas Hold'em. Many players fail to assess the true value of marginal hands, leading them to invest chips in unfavorable situations and thus lowering their overall EV. This article uses hand analysis to explain why marginal hands are easily suppressed and difficult to play for value, and why expert players deliberately avoid such decisions. When players can reduce their use of marginal hands and focus on high-quality opportunities, they can effectively reduce losses and improve long-term profitability.
